Born on January 30, 1930, Osamu Suzuki graduated from Chuo University’s Faculty of Law. He joined Suzuki Motor Co Ltd in April 1958 and quickly rose through the ranks. By November 1963, he was appointed Director, and by December 1967, he became Director and Managing Director. His leadership continued as he took on the role of Chairman of Suzuki Motor Corporation in June 2000.
Osamu Suzuki’s Legacy in India
Suzuki’s vision for India was realised through his partnership with the Indian government in 1981. This collaboration led to the creation of Maruti Udyog Ltd, which later became Maruti Suzuki India Ltd after the government exited in 2007. His efforts were pivotal in making affordable and reliable vehicles accessible to millions of Indian families.
Maruti Suzuki India Ltd expressed deep admiration for Suzuki’s impact on the country. “He played a pivotal role in realising the dream of putting India on wheels by empowering millions of Indian families with affordable, reliable, efficient and good quality vehicles,” they stated upon his passing last year.

Suzuki’s influence extended beyond business; he earned the trust of several Indian Prime Ministers. His close relationship with current Prime Minister Narendra Modi is particularly noteworthy. This mutual understanding underscored his commitment to India’s growth and development.
In June 2021, Osamu Suzuki transitioned to a Senior Advisor role at Suzuki Motor Corporation. His eldest son, Toshihiro Suzuki, succeeded him as the leader of the company. This transition marked a new chapter while maintaining the family’s legacy within the corporation.
Other Notable Padma Awardees
This year’s Padma awards also recognised other notable figures in trade and industry. Nalli Kuppuswami Chetti of Nalli saris received the Padma Bhushan. Pankaj Patel, Chairman of Zydus Lifesciences, was also honoured with a Padma Bhushan. The Padma Shri was awarded to Pawan Goenka from IN-SPACe and Sajjan Bhajanka from Century Plyboards.
Sally Holkar, co-founder of REHWA SOCIETY, was another recipient of the Padma Shri. These awards highlight significant contributions across various sectors, celebrating individuals who have made impactful advancements in their respective fields.
